Transaction 7732361d5e90217d5156c4d61002a0e8f819ac8c5773b8a5c7f64e679adb3f92
1 Input
1 Output
-
7732361d5e90217d5156c4d61002a0e8f819ac8c5773b8a5c7f64e679adb3f92:0
- value
- 611813
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ac56ff1de97ee0e73af5a505103e2034fe30d4f OP_EQUAL
- address
- 39xyFzTgVbt6RaMFn2B9cqWMWNB6cX3rnB